Eager is definitely a fun name, but imagine going through high school with it. The favorite question from guys was, “Are you?” Another fave was “Eager Beaver,” even into adulthood. Somehow, whenever anyone said “Eager Beaver,” they had the feeling they were being original. I could never quite figure that one out. My line became: “Like I’ve never heard that before.”

I work in radio and was getting ready to do a report one morning when the disc jockey asks, “Are you married?” “No,” I replied. “You know if you married a guy with the last name of Beaver, you could be Jo Eager-Beaver!” It was 5:00 in the morning. The coffee hadn’t kicked in. Did he really expect a laugh from me? Sorry, I couldn’t even fake it.

Jo is my middle name and that’s what everyone calls me. Being a female Jo is semi-unique. There are a few of us out there. This, too, sometimes brought a few laughs from the guys in high school. Apparently they’d never known a girl Jo. The teacher, when taking attendance the first day, asked if we had a nickname. “Mary Jo,” he said when he got to my name. “Call me Jo,” I said. I felt my cheeks turn pink when the boys chuckled.

My first name is Mary. That may not sound unique. After all, there are Mary’s all over the place. What’s different about it for me is that I have three sisters—and all three of them have names starting with the letter “B.” I’m not the oldest, nor the youngest. I’m in the middle, right behind Barbara and Beverly and before Beth.

“What’s up with that? Why didn’t I get a “B” name?” I asked my mom. “I love the name Mary and always wanted a Mary,” she said. Actually, I was not her only daughter without a “B”. She had a daughter a few years before me that only lived four days. She was named Rosemary. I wondered if my mom named me after her. “No,” she told me. “Would you have named me Mary Jo if Rosemary had lived,” I asked. “No,” she replied.

So, I’m not named after anyone in particular. Mom liked the name Mary and thought Jo went well with it. Ironically, Mary was never me. I was always called Jo.

A friend of mine, who also works in radio and television, told me when he first heard my name, he thought it was the best radio name he’d ever heard. I’ve even been asked if it was a made-up air name. Let’s face it, though—if you were making up a name for yourself, you probably wouldn’t pick a predominantly male name…and then add Eager to it.

So, am I? Yes, I’m Eager.
